James H Hara 1932 - 1999

James H Hara of Honolulu, Honolulu County, HI was born on November 27, 1932, and died at age 66 years old on October 9, 1999. James Hara was buried at National Memorial Cemetery Of The Pacific Section CT4-Q Row 600 Site 620 2177 Puowaina Drive, in Honolulu.
